Introduction of Hanuman
Hanuman is a prominent figure in Hindu mythology and one of Lord Rama's most devoted followers. He is widely known as the monkey god, often depicted with a human body and the head, tail, and arms of a monkey. Hanuman is revered for his extraordinary strength, agility, and devotion to Lord Rama. According to Hindu mythology, Hanuman helped Lord Rama rescue his wife Sita from the demon king Ravana by using his powers to leap across the ocean and reach the kingdom of Lanka. He is also associated with the Hanuman Chalisa, a devotional poem that is recited by millions of Hindus every day to seek his blessings and protection. Hanuman is considered a guardian deity, particularly for children, students, and those seeking to overcome obstacles in their lives.
